The gaming world is in a state of flux as ISOFT recently
announced the discontinuation of "The Crew," a popular online
multiplayer game. This decision has left players and the gaming community at
large reflecting on the broader implications of such events. In this article,
we'll delve into the reasons behind this move, the impact on players, and the
evolving landscape of online gaming.
I. Introduction
The era of online gaming has witnessed a dynamic shift, with
multiplayer games becoming the heartbeat of the gaming industry. Among these,
"The Crew" stood as a testament to the evolution of gaming
experiences. However, ISOFT’s recent decision to stop selling the game and shut
down its servers next year has sent shockwaves through the gaming community.

IV. "The Crew" - A Nostalgic Journey
"The Crew" was more than just a game; it was a
journey for players exploring a vast, open-world landscape. Launched with much
anticipation, the game offered a unique blend of racing and exploration,
creating lasting memories for those who embraced its virtual roads.
